Understanding Website Architecture and Its Impact on Indexation

Website architecture refers to the structural design of your site, including how pages are organized, linked, and accessed. A logical, hierarchical structure ensures that search engines can crawl and understand your content efficiently. Poor architecture, characterized by orphan pages, deep nesting, or broken links, impairs indexation, reduces visibility, and hampers user experience.

Optimizing website architecture traditionally involved manual audits, user testing, and heuristic analysis. However, these methods are time-consuming and often fall short in capturing the dynamic complexities of modern websites. Today, AI offers a scalable, intelligent alternative for analyzing and enhancing site structure with precision and speed.

Implementing AI for Website Architecture Optimization

Getting started isn't as daunting as it might seem. Here’s a step-by-step approach to integrating AI into your site structure enhancement process:

1. Conduct a Comprehensive Site Audit

Utilize AI tools like aio for automated site audits. These tools inspect every aspect of your architecture, providing detailed reports on issues and opportunities.

2. Analyze Content Clusters and User Flows

Leverage AI's semantic analysis capabilities to categorize your content into logical groups. This step facilitates creating a navigational hierarchy that aligns with user intent.

3. Optimize Internal Linking and URL Structure

Deploy AI-driven tools to establish relevant internal links and clean URL hierarchies, improving the crawlability and indexing efficiency of your website.

4. Monitor and Refine Strategy with Data Insights

Employ analytics dashboards powered by AI to track how search engines crawl your site and adjust your structure in real-time for continuous improvement.
